Output 1999c4666b160aa524eff18457ec9e2b1fbc02085c09bbd4a1f3b0369615fb5e:2

value
3843664
script pubkey
OP_0 OP_PUSHBYTES_20 126408ac9871bda8e74e00d6fe710cd590d1652f
address
bc1qzfjq3tycwx763e6wqrt0uugv6kgdzef0ux74yy
transaction
1999c4666b160aa524eff18457ec9e2b1fbc02085c09bbd4a1f3b0369615fb5e
spent
true